Catalog Course Description:    
  This course is designed to provide instruction in implementing and administering a Windows 2000 network infrastructure.  Topics include installing, configuring, managing, monitoring and troubleshooting DNS, WINS, network address translation; and certificate services.

I. Week/Unit/Topic Basis:    
  Week  Topic
  1 Designing a Windows 2000 Network
  2 Implementing TCP/IP
  3 Implementing NWLink
  4 Monitoring Network Activity
  5 Implementing IPSec
  6 Exam One
  7 Resolving Network Host Names
  8 Implementing Domain Name System (DNS)
  9 Using 2000 Domain Name Service
  10 Implementing Windows Internet Name Service (WINS)
  11 Implementing Dynamic Host Configuration Protocol (DHCP)
  12 Providing Your Clients Remote Access Service (RAS)
  13 Supporting Network Address Translation (NAT)
  14 Implementing Certificate Services
  15 Implementing Enterprise-Wide Network Security
  16 Group Project; FInal Exam Period
